Alexei David Sayle was born on August 7, 1952, in Liverpool, England. Growing up, his parents encouraged him to pursue his creative interests, which eventually led him to a career in comedy. Sayle attended Chelsea College of Art and Design in London, where he honed his artistic skills and began exploring his comedic talents.
In the early 1980s, Sayle emerged as a prominent figure in the alternative comedy scene in the UK. Known for his unique style and cutting-edge humor, he quickly gained a loyal following. His bold and irreverent approach to comedy set him apart from his peers, and he soon became a pioneer in the genre.
Before rising to fame as a comedian, Sayle was actively involved in Britain's Communist Party. His political beliefs and social activism often influenced his comedic material, making him a controversial and polarizing figure in the entertainment industry.
In 2007, Sayle was honored by Channel 4 as one of the greatest stand-up comedians of all time, ranking number eighteen on their prestigious list. This recognition solidified his status as a comedic trailblazer and cemented his place in the annals of comedy history.
